Why supplier capability matters more than a part number

A crankshaft pulley can look simple while still carrying tight functional requirements. For B2B buyers, supplier capability is the difference between a part that fits on day one and a part that creates belt noise, vibration, or premature bearing load.

A serious supplier should be able to document:

  • CNC machining capability for bore, face, and concentric features
  • Dynamic balancing control where the design requires it
  • Incoming inspection for bar, casting, or forged blanks
  • Batch traceability from raw material to finished carton
  • Packaging that prevents flange damage and oil contamination
  • Stable lead times for repeat orders and programme replenishment

If you are comparing OEM supplier options, ask how the factory manages PPAP-style documentation, first article checks, and running change control. For buyers who need non-standard geometry or private-label packaging, custom manufacturing is usually the correct path rather than forcing a generic catalogue part into a constrained application.

Quality controls that reduce warranty risk

The best supplier evidence is not a sales statement. It is process control.

Driventus uses a documented quality system aligned with IATF 16949:2016 and ISO 9001:2015. For crankshaft pulleys, the controls that matter most are:

  • Concentricity and runout checks against the drawing
  • Bore diameter inspection and fit verification
  • Torque retention or fastening interface checks, where applicable
  • Balance verification for dynamically sensitive designs
  • Surface finish and coating thickness checks
  • Salt-spray or corrosion testing when specified by the buyer

For markets with emissions or durability-related compliance questions, purchasers may also ask whether the component fits programmes referenced under REACH (EC) No 1907/2006 and, where relevant to the vehicle system, ECE R-83 or SAE J2527 test plans. Those references do not replace buyer specification control, but they help align expectations between engineering, quality, and commercial teams.

A supplier should be able to provide inspection records by lot, not only a generic certificate.

Commercial terms that matter in international sourcing

For import managers, the technical fit is only half the decision. The commercial structure has to support repeat supply.

Typical points to lock down early:

  • MOQ by part number, not by product family
  • Standard lead time for sample, trial, and mass production
  • Incoterms and packing specification
  • Country-of-origin marking and carton labelling
  • Spare-parts availability window for mature programmes
  • Change-control notice period for tooling, material, or finish changes

If a Peugeot application is forecasted across several regions, separate the launch quantity from the steady-state replenishment plan. That makes it easier to protect service stock without overcommitting inventory. Buyers often reduce risk by requesting a pilot lot first, then moving to scheduled releases once dimensional stability is confirmed.

How to compare suppliers on a like-for-like basis

Use the same evaluation sheet for every quote. Otherwise, price comparisons are not meaningful.

A practical scorecard looks like this:

1. Drawing match: confirmed against the same revision level 2. Material declaration: available and consistent with the application 3. Dimensional report: supplied with sample or first batch 4. Process control: machining, balancing, coating, and packaging documented 5. Traceability: lot codes and retention records available 6. Logistics: lead time, palletisation, and export readiness 7. Commercial risk: warranty handling, claim response, and replacement policy

For larger programmes, ask the supplier to explain where standardisation is possible and where a custom setup is safer. The lowest unit price is not useful if the part requires rework, field replacement, or emergency air freight.

Recommended specification pack before ordering

Before releasing purchase orders, ask for a complete pack that includes the following:

  • Engineering drawing with tolerances
  • Material and finish declaration
  • Dimensional inspection report
  • Balance or runout record, if applicable
  • Packaging specification
  • Traceability format and lot marking example
  • Sample approval or trial lot summary

This pack lets the buyer, receiving team, and downstream distributor check the same facts. It also reduces the chance that a visually similar pulley enters the wrong SKU bucket. For Peugeot programmes with multiple engine variants, the specification pack should be tied to the exact application and not just a broad vehicle platform description.

Item What to confirm Why it matters
Outer diameterMatch to belt path and accessory drive speedA small change affects alternator and A/C load
Bore and keyingCrank nose fit and retention methodControls concentricity and installation reliability
Offset and groove countAlignment with the accessory drivePrevents belt walk and abnormal wear
Damping designSolid, decoupled, or elastomer bondedImpacts vibration control and service life
Material and coatingSteel, cast iron, phosphate, e-coat, or zinc finishAffects corrosion resistance and mass
